New Signed Agreement Expands Wing It On! in Central Florida

Experienced Business Owner Signs Deal with Popular Wing Joint for New Location in Mount Dora

October 05, 2022 // Franchising.com // MOUNT DORA, Fla. - Wing It On! has announced a new signed agreement with local entrepreneur, Jayesh Patel, to bring a new location to Mount Dora, Florida.

“For my next business venture, I knew I wanted to get into the restaurant industry, specifically in the chicken category. I did my due diligence by researching a number of different brands to franchise with, and Wing It On! really stood out from the rest,” said Patel, who previously owned three gas stations throughout the Mount Dora area.

Wing It On! has earned a loyal fan following redefining the standards for fresh and crispy wings. With a simplified, innovative menu, fans of the brand have favored the true Buffalo-quality wing cooked and sauced or seasoned to perfection. In addition to its famous wings and tenders, Wing It On! also serves a full-line up of hand-crafted crispy chicken sandwiches, sides and irresistible customizable seasoned fries.

“Entering the Mount Dora market with a business owner as familiar with the area as Jayesh is a great next step for us,” said Matt Ensero, founder and CEO of Wing It On!. “I look forward to expanding our chicken concept’s presence in the Sunshine State.”

Creating a wing experience goes back to the early 2000s when Ensero, and his friends would argue amongst themselves every football Sunday about who was driving 30-plus minutes to pick up wings from some of their favorite spots in surrounding towns. However, the distance and Styrofoam take out boxes would always result in soggy and cold wings once they got home. Ensero had enough, hence, Wing It On! was born. He opened the first Wing It On! in his hometown Waterbury, Connecticut, serving only the crispiest of wings that all true wing nuts crave.
